typedef
struct Waitmsg
{
        int pid;        /* of loved one */
        unsigned long time[3];  /* of loved one & descendants */
        char    *msg;
} Waitmsg;

#define STATMAX 65535U  /* max length of machine-independent stat structure */
#define DIRMAX  (sizeof(Dir)+STATMAX)   /* max length of Dir structure */
#define ERRMAX  128     /* max length of error string */

#define MORDER  0x0003  /* mask for bits defining order of mounting */
#define MREPL   0x0000  /* mount replaces object */
#define MBEFORE 0x0001  /* mount goes before others in union directory */
#define MAFTER  0x0002  /* mount goes after others in union directory */
#define MCREATE 0x0004  /* permit creation in mounted directory */
#define MCACHE  0x0010  /* cache some data */
#define MMASK   0x0007  /* all bits on */

#define OREAD   0        /* open for read */
#define OWRITE  1       /* write */
#define ORDWR   2       /* read and write */
#define OEXEC   3       /* execute, == read but check execute permission */
#define OTRUNC  16      /* or'ed in (except for exec), truncate file first */
#define OCEXEC  32      /* or'ed in, close on exec */
#define ORCLOSE 64      /* or'ed in, remove on close */
#define OEXCL   0x1000  /* or'ed in, exclusive use (create only) */

#define AEXIST  0        /* accessible: exists */
#define AEXEC   1       /* execute access */
#define AWRITE  2       /* write access */
#define AREAD   4       /* read access */

/* Segattch */
#define SG_RONLY        0040    /* read only */
#define SG_CEXEC        0100    /* detach on exec */

#define NCONT   0        /* continue after note */
#define NDFLT   1       /* terminate after note */
#define NSAVE   2       /* clear note but hold state */
#define NRSTR   3       /* restore saved state */

/* bits in Qid.type */
#define QTDIR           0x80            /* type bit for directories */
#define QTAPPEND        0x40            /* type bit for append only files */
#define QTEXCL          0x20            /* type bit for exclusive use files */
#define QTMOUNT         0x10            /* type bit for mounted channel */
#define QTFILE          0x00            /* plain file */

/* bits in Dir.mode */
#define DMDIR           0x80000000      /* mode bit for directories */
#define DMAPPEND        0x40000000      /* mode bit for append only files */
#define DMEXCL          0x20000000      /* mode bit for exclusive use files */
#define DMMOUNT         0x10000000      /* mode bit for mounted channel */
#define DMREAD          0x4             /* mode bit for read permission */
#define DMWRITE         0x2             /* mode bit for write permission */
#define DMEXEC          0x1             /* mode bit for execute permission */

/* rfork */
enum
{
        RFNAMEG         = (1<<0),
        RFENVG          = (1<<1),
        RFFDG           = (1<<2),
        RFNOTEG         = (1<<3),
        RFPROC          = (1<<4),
        RFMEM           = (1<<5),
        RFNOWAIT        = (1<<6),
        RFCNAMEG        = (1<<10),
        RFCENVG         = (1<<11),
        RFCFDG          = (1<<12),
        RFREND          = (1<<13),
        RFNOMNT         = (1<<14)
};
